Pitch
is a football stadium in , , which has been home to Glentoran F.C. since 1892. In 1941, the stadium was severely damaged by aerial bombing during the Belfast blitz of World War II and was unusable until 1949. is situated 1 mile northwest of Jellybean Cafe.

Movie theater
The Strand Arts Centre, also known as is an independent four-screen cinema in Strandtown on Holywood Road in , . It is one of the two remaining independent cinemas in Belfast, alongside the Queen's Film Theatre. is situated 2,100 feet northwest of Jellybean Cafe.
